Bauchi Rotary club reiterates commitment to humanitarian support, service


By Monday Danladi

Rotary Club of Bauchi Central has reiterated its commitment to humanitarian services as a way of supporting the government in its developmental efforts.

This was said by the President of the Club, Rotarian Adeyemi Adekunle, during the unveiling of asignpost erected in Miri Community along the Bauchi - Jos Federal highway. 

According to him, "Since we started the Rotary Club in Bauchi, we realized that people are not much aware that the Rotary Club exists in Bauchi. So we need to mount signposts to signify that the Rotary Club exists in Bauchi. In fact, this is our first Rotary Public TV in Bauchi." 

He added that, "This is the first signpost project we are commissioning in Bauchi. And we have four other signposts to commission. They are Jos Road, Gombe Road, Maiduguri Bypass, and Kano Road." 

The President further said that, "We still have other signposts to commission. This is the first one. Just to create awareness that Rotary Club exists in Bauchi to increase our members.

He also stated that it will be an avenue for membership drive stressing that, "We need more members to enable us to have more funds to serve humanity in the areas of health and education."

The Club President further stressed that Rotary Club International has a seat at the UN General Assembly because of the enormous humanitarian work it is doing across the world.

He assured that the Club will soon visit the Secondary school in Miri to donate more reusable sanitary pads to the female students as well as give them talks on how to live a life of cleanliness during their monthly flow. 

According to him, "The Rotary Club of Bauchi Central is contributing to family health as well as Water, Sanitation and Hygiene (WASH) services for healthy living. 

Speaking at the commissioning ceremony, the District Head of Miri, Alh Hussaini Abubakar, commended Rotary Club of Bauchi Central for embarking on people oriented development projects especially in the health and education sectors, thereby improving living conditions of the people. 

Represented by the Sarkin Malaman Miri, Alhaji Sunusi Abubakar, the traditional ruler appreciated the Rotary Club for the various project interventions in Miri community. 

He specifically commended the provision of toilets to the Secondary School there as well as the donation of reusable sanitary pads to female students of the school. 

The District Head assured that the community will continue to support Rotary Club of Bauchi Central in its humanitarian services urging for more support and intervention.
